Abstract:
There are provided an imaging device, an information acquisition method, and an information acquisition program that can simply and accurately acquire information related to a ray angle with respect to an image sensor in a case where subject light is incident on the image sensor through an interchangeable lens even though the interchangeable lens having no compatibility is mounted on the imaging device. An image sensor (201) including first phase difference pixels and second phase difference pixels is moved between a first position (P1) and a second position (P2) in the direction of an optical axis of an interchangeable lens. Information related to a ray angle with respect to the image sensor (201) in a case where subject light is incident on the image sensor (201) through the interchangeable lens is acquired on the basis of the outputs of the first and second phase difference pixels in a case where the image sensor (201) is moved to the first position (P1) and the outputs of the first and second phase difference pixels in a case where the image sensor (201) is moved to the second position (P2).

Abstract:
The imaging device 1 has an image sensor 14 and an electronic diaphragm section. In the image sensor 14, a plurality of pixels having an organic layer for photoelectric conversion is two-dimensionally arranged. Each pixel of the image sensor 14 is divided into a plurality of regions. The pixel has an on-chip microlens 15, which forms a pupil image of a photography optical system 12 on the plurality of regions, and reading sections 16 which respectively read photoelectrically converted signals of the divided regions. The electronic diaphragm section electronically controls an aperture value, and selects divided regions, which are read by the reading sections 16, on the basis of the aperture value, or selects a signal from the signals of the plurality of divided regions, which are read by the reading sections 16, on the basis of the aperture value.

Abstract:
It is intended to provide an imaging apparatus that enables proper exposure of phase difference detection pixels and thereby makes it possible to perform phase difference autofocusing with high accuracy. A system control unit 11 selects phase difference detection pixels from phase difference detection pixels 51R and 51L existing in a selected phase difference detection area 52 according to a position of the selected phase difference detection area 52 in a row direction X, and determines exposure conditions based on output signals of the selected phase difference detection pixels. A defocus amount calculation unit 19 calculates a defocus amount using output signals of the phase difference detection pixels 51R and 51L existing in the selected phase difference detection area 52 that are part of a shot image signal produced by shooting that is performed by an imaging device 5 under the exposure conditions determined by the exposure determining unit 11.

Abstract:
A digital camera 10 includes an imaging device 21a, a finder device 15, a phase difference information analyzing portion 71 and a control portion 32. In the finder device 15, an image in which an OVF optical image formed by an objective optical system 65 and an image displayed on a display portion 61 are superimposed on each other can be observed through an eyepiece window 17. The phase difference information analyzing portion 71 determines a focus region and a non-focus region in a photographic subject imaged by the imaging device 21a. The control portion 32 makes control to display an image Eg for highlighting the focus region E in the OVF optical image on the display portion 61 in the state in which the OVF optical image can be observed through the eyepiece window 17.
Abstract:
An image capturing apparatus includes: an image capturing element in which a plurality of pixels and phase difference pixels are formed within an effective pixel region; a photographing lens; a phase difference amount detecting unit analyzing a captured image signal and obtaining a phase difference amount from detection signals of two of the phase difference pixels that make a pair; and a control unit obtaining a defocus amount of a photographic subject image from the detected phase difference amount and performing a focusing control, in which the control unit obtains a parameter value regarding a ratio of the defocus amount and the phase difference amount based on photographing lens information of the photographing lens and a light receiving sensitivity distribution indicating sensitivity for each incident angle of incident light for the two of the phase difference pixels that make the pair, and obtains the defocus amount.
